Why Each Kid Should Join a Youth Basketball League
Youth basketball leagues are more than just an after-school activity. They offer children a enjoyable, structured way to develop lifelong skills, build friendships, and stay healthy. Whether or not your child dreams of playing professionally someday or just wants to be active with friends, basketball provides dependless benefits that extend far beyond the court.
Physical Health and Fitness
Probably the most obvious reasons kids should join a youth basketball league is the positive impact on physical health. Basketball is a fast-paced game that improves cardiovascular endurance, coordination, and muscle strength. Running up and down the court builds stamina, while leaping for rebounds and shooting hoops enhances agility and balance.
In an age where screen time often replaces outside play, basketball keeps kids moving. Common practices and games be sure that children get consistent train, which helps combat obesity, improves bone health, and supports total wellness. Establishing healthy activity habits at a young age can set the foundation for a lifetime of fitness.
Building Social Skills
Youth basketball leagues are also great environments for growing social skills. Kids learn to work as part of a team, talk successfully, and assist each other during both wins and losses. These social interactions teach empathy, respect, and cooperation—skills which are essential in school, future careers, and on a regular basis life.
Joining a league also creates opportunities for friendships outside of school. Many players bond over shared experiences on the court, and people friendships often extend beyond practices and games. For children who could struggle socially, basketball affords a standard ground that makes connecting with peers easier.
Developing Discipline and Responsibility
Playing in a youth basketball league requires commitment. Players should attend practices, show up for games, and respect coaches’ instructions. This routine teaches responsibility and discipline— traits that benefit children far past sports.
Kids quickly be taught that success in basketball comes from follow, endurance, and perseverance. Lacking practices or not putting in effort can have an effect on each their performance and their team’s success. These lessons translate directly into schoolwork and personal responsibilities, serving to children understand the worth of consistency and dedication.
Confidence and Self-Esteem Boost
Basketball offers kids the prospect to set goals and achieve them. Whether or not it’s learning to dribble with their non-dominant hand, scoring their first basket, or mastering defensive skills, every accomplishment builds confidence.
Coaches often encourage players to deal with improvement relatively than perfection, serving to kids understand that mistakes are part of learning. This positive reinforcement boosts shallowness and teaches children resilience. The ability to bounce back after lacking a shot or losing a game strengthens their mental toughness—a skill that will help them face challenges in all areas of life.
Academic and Cognitive Benefits
Surprisingly, basketball can even help with academics. The sport requires quick decision-making, strategic thinking, and focus—all of which sharpen cognitive skills. Research have shown that children who participate in organized sports often perform better academically because they be taught time management and develop stronger concentration.
By balancing schoolwork with observe schedules, kids improve their organizational skills. In addition they be taught the significance of setting priorities, which is crucial for academic success.
A Positive Outlet for Energy
Youth basketball leagues provide kids with a constructive outlet for energy and emotions. Instead of being glued to phones or video games, children have a safe, supervised space to release stress and stay active. Enjoying basketball is just not only physically beneficial but additionally an awesome way to improve mental health by reducing nervousness and boosting mood through exercise.
Lifelong Love for the Game
Finally, joining a youth basketball league usually sparks a lifelong passion for the sport. Some children might continue taking part in in high school, college, or leisure leagues as adults. Others might develop an interest in coaching, refereeing, or simply enjoying basketball as fans. Regardless of the path, being part of a youth league lays the foundation for an enduring appreciation of teamwork, sportsmanship, and active living.
Youth basketball leagues are about more than competition—they’re about development, fun, and community. From boosting health and confidence to building friendships and discipline, the benefits are undeniable. For parents looking to present their children an opportunity that blends fitness, skill-building, and social development, enrolling in a youth basketball league is a slam dunk decision.
